>> I have done jffs2 image with --pad option to match my flash size and it
>> works fine. However, if I want to use summary, the sumtool creates smaller
>> image than original padded jffs2 image and the flash isn't fully used.
>> I write the jffs2 image using bootloader, where I set the size of the
>> flashing length match the filesize. Is there any way to pad summed
>> image to larger so that i can fully occupy flash?
>> sumtool -p option doesn't allow to set filesize.
>>
>
> If your flash is NAND flash I do not recommend you to pad it because
> writing FFs may have side-effects.
>
>
Yes it is NAND flash. I tried to add dummy file to my filesystem to
increase the size of image and after that remove that dummy file to free
space, unfortunately I couldn't remove the file cause the filesystem was
100% full,
and that's the real problem.
